Support Vector Machine and Spectral Angle Mapper Classifications of High Resolution Hyper Spectral Aerial Image

  • This paper presents two different types of supervised classifiers such as support vector machine (SVM) and spectral angle mapper (SAM). The Compact Airborne Spectrographic Imager (CASI) high resolution aerial image was classified with the above two classifier. The image was classified into eight land use /land cover classes. Accuracy assessment and Kappa statistics were estimated for SVM and SAM separately. The overall classification accuracy and Kappa statistics value of the SAM were 69.0% and 0.62 respectively, which were higher than those of SVM (62.5%, 0.54).

Integrating Spatial Proximity with Manifold Learning for Hyperspectral Data

  • High spectral resolution of hyperspectral data enables analysis of complex natural phenomena that is reflected on the data nonlinearly. Although many manifold learning methods have been developed for such problems, most methods do not consider the spatial correlation between samples that is inherent and useful in remote sensing data. We propose a manifold learning method which directly combines the spatial proximity and the spectral similarity through kernel PCA framework. A gain factor caused by spatial proximity is first modelled with a heat kernel, and is added to the original similarity computed from the spectral values of a pair of samples. Parameters are tuned with intelligent grid search (IGS) method for the derived manifold coordinates to achieve optimal classification accuracies. Of particular interest is its performance with small training size, because labelled samples are usually scarce due to its high acquisition cost. The proposed spatial kernel PCA (KPCA) is compared with PCA in terms of classification accuracy with the nearest-neighbourhood classification method.

Study on spectral indices for crop growth monitoring

  • The objective of this paper is to determine the suitable spectral bands for monitoring growth status change during a long period. The long-term ground-level reflectance spectra as well as LAI and biomass were obtained in xiaotangshan area, Beijing, 2001. The narrow-band NDVI type spectral indices by all possible two bands were calculated their correlation coefficients R$^2$ with biomass and LAI. The best NDVIs must have higher R$^2$ with both biomass and LAI. The reasonable band centers and band widths were determined by a systematically increasing bandwidth centered over a wavelength. In addition, the first 19 bands of MODIS were simulated and investigated. Each developed spectral indices was then validated by the biomass and LAI time series using the generalized vector angle. It turned out that six new NDVI type indices within 750-1400nm were developed. NDVI(811_10,957_10) and NDVI(962_10,802_10) performed best. No satisfactory conventional NDVI formed by red and NIR bands were found effective. MODIS_NDVI(band19, band17) and MODIS_NDVI(band19, band2) were much better than MODIS_NDVI(band2,band1) for growth monitoring.

Application of Hyperion Hyperspectral Remote Sensing Data for Wildfire Fuel Mapping

  • Fire fuel map is one of the most critical factors for planning and managing the fire hazard and risk. However, fuel mapping is extremely difficult because fuel properties vary at spatial scales, change depending on the seasonal situations and are affected by the surrounding environment. Remote sensing has potential to reduce the uncertainty in mapping fuels and offers the best approach for improving our abilities. Especially, Hyperspectral sensor have a great potential for mapping vegetation properties because of their high spectral resolution. The objective of this paper is to evaluate the potential of mapping fuel properties using Hyperion hyperspectral remote sensing data acquired in April, 2002. Fuel properties are divided into four broad categories: 1) fuel moisture, 2) fuel green live biomass, 3) fuel condition and 4) fuel types. Fuel moisture and fuel green biomass were assessed using canopy moisture, derived from the expression of liquid water in the reflectance spectrum of plants. Fuel condition was assessed using endmember fractions from spectral mixture analysis (SMA). Fuel types were classified by fuel models based on the results of SMA. Although Hyperion imagery included a lot of sensor noise and poor performance in liquid water band, the overall results showed that Hyperion imagery have good potential for wildfire fuel mapping.

초분광 원격탐사의 특성, 처리기법 및 활용 현용 (Current Status of Hyperspectral Remote Sensing: Principle, Data Processing Techniques, and Applications)

  • 이 연구는 새로운 광학원격탐사자료로 대두되고 있는 초분광영상의 기본적 특성과 용어에 관한 정의를 검토하고, 지금까지 초분광영상과 관련된 주요 처리기법 및 활용분야를 광범위하게 검토하여 국내에서 초분광영상 기술의 활용을 위한 기초 자료를 제공하고자 한다. 먼저 문헌자료와 인터넷 검색을 통하여 항공기 및 위성탑재 센서와 지상용 카메라 등 현존하는 초분광센서의 종류 및 특성을 제시하였다 초분광영상과 관련된 연구 현황을 분석하기 위하여 원격탐사와 관련된 주요 국제학술지와 초분광영상 관련 학술발표회에서 발표된 논문들을 선정하여 센서별, 영상처리기법별, 주요 활용분야별로 나누어 정리하였다. 현재 항공기 및 위성 탑재 초분광영상 센서의 종류가 증가하고 있는 추세지만, 지금까지 초분광영상과 관련된 연구의 주된 부분은 미국 항공우주국에서 개발된 AVIRIS영상자료를 토대로 하고 있다. 기존의 다중분광영상에 보다 많은 분광밴드를 가진 초분광영상의 특성을 최대한 이용할 수 있는 영상처리기법이 개발되고 있다. 대기보정, 분광혼합분석, 특징추출 등이 초분광영상처리와 관련된 중요한 분야로 대두되고 있으나, 아직까지 보편적인 초분광영상 처리기술로 자리 잡기까지는 보다 많은 연구가 필요한 실정이다. 초분광영상이 가지고 있는 분광특성 정보를 최대한 이용하기에 적합한 암석 및 광물탐사가 초기의 주된 활용분야였으나, 식물의 물리화학적 정보 추출, 수질, 군용목표물 탐지 등 초분광영상의 활용은 기존의 다중분광영상의 한계를 극복하는 측면에서 확대될 전망이다.

Spectral Reflectance Signatures of Major Upland Crops at OSMI Bands

  • Spectral reflectance signatures of upland crops at OSMI bands were collected and evaluated for the feasibility of crop discrimination knowledge-based on crop calendar. Effective bands and their ratio values for discriminating corn from two other legumes were defined with OSMI equivalent bands and their ratio values. June 22 among measurements dates was the best date for corn discrimination from two other legumes, peanut and soybean, because all OSMI equivalent bands and their ratio values in June 22 were highly significant for corn separability. Phenological growth stage of a silage corn (rs510) could be estimated as a function of spectral reflectance signatures in vegetative stage. Five growth stage prediction models were generated by the SAS procedures REG and STEPWISE with OSMI equivalent bands and their ratio values in vegetative stage.

Availability of Normalized Spectra of Landsat/TM Data by Their Band Sum

  • In satellite spectra, Though the magnitude varies with intensity of sunstroke, dip angle of land so on, the shape is less deformed with these effects. from this point of view, we have developed a spectral shape-dependent analysis utilizing a normalization procedure by the spectral integral and applied it to Landsat/TM spectra. Inevitable topographic and atmospheric effects can be suppressed. The correction algorithm is very simple and timesaving and the suppression of topographic effects is especially effective. Normalized band 4 is almost linear to NDVI values, and is available to the vegetation index.

Spectral Sensing for Plant Stress Assessment - A Review -

  • Assessment of nitrogen and chlorophyll content from crop leaves can help growers adjust N fertilizer rates to meet the demands of the crop. Numerous researchers have presented their studies about spectral signature of plant leaves to characterize the plant features. However, interrelational review and summary were limited and a communication gap exists between the plant science and optical engineering. Understanding the mechanism of leaf interaction to electromagnetic radiation and factors affecting spectrophotometric measurements can enhance the foundation of optical remote sensing technologies. This paper provides extensive review of previous works in optical sensing and explains the basics of plant optics, spectral measurements for plant stress, factors that affect sensitivity to spectral analysis, and applications that deploy optical remote sensing technologies.
